Sponsors, Donators, Investors Boot InterGOV

Lockdown Corporation

InterGOV International has for a long time proudly displayed the below on its pages:

Investor:

LockDown Corporation
Michael Paris - General Manager

www.lockdowncorp.com

Investment:

Provides Software and Services which allow us to:

Track hackers and other illegal activities.
Stop hackers and prevent viruses.
Eliminate spam and pop-ups.
Secure servers and PC's.
- and -
Provides our investigators with secure proxy connections.

Lockdown Corporation have now formally demanded the removal of links to them from the InterGOV sites within 24 hours, however this e-mail was sent about 2 weeks ago and no reply was ever received by Lockdown Corporation. You can read the original e-mail which was sent to Peter Hampton's Director@InterGOV.Org e-mail address further below along with complete e-mail headers. The above link can be found HERE and others on the lower right of each of their pages.

Michael Paris from Lockdown Corporation has kindly given us his full permission to publish this e-mail as InterGOV have yet to comply with his wishes to have his company name disassociated with InterGOV. Mr. Paris was under the illusion that InterGOV had official status as he was led to believe by both Peter Hampton and his representatives that he had been in contact with. A visit to our site, the recent letter from the State of Florida and a couple of telephone enquiries were able to soon persuade Mr. Paris that this was not the case.

Mr. Paris kindly contacted us regarding our site to thank us and make us aware that after learning that InterGOV has no official status that he would be demanding removal of any links to his sites from the InterGOV sites and withdrawing the services he had kindly donated. We have been aware of this for some time but were awaiting the final outcome before publishing anything about it in order to give InterGOV ample time to remove their links before making any comment on it.

As they have still not removed the links to Lockdown Corporation, Michael Paris has given us the go ahead and his blessing to publish the article early due to their failure to respond. It will be interesting to see their reaction to the registered letter they are likely to receive.

It is good to see that public spirited companies are now withdrawing their sponsorships to the InterGOV agencies upon discovering that they are not official or even officially recognized, but in fact run by an individual. It appears that Peter Hampton gave Mr. Paris the impression that he was officially recognized and endorsed to run his misleading agencies, we however know different and now so do Lockdown Corporation. They do not wish their name or corporate image to be associated with anything that is not legitimate or that has been misrepresented to them.

We are pleased that sponsors are now withdrawing their support for InterGOV since finding out that they were deceived into giving this support in the first place. I intend to write to other sponsors they list shortly to see if they are also aware of the real status of InterGOV or whether they are also under the misguided notion that they were giving to an officially recognized and endorsed not for profit organization.
